* elf-attrs.c (_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_low,

_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_list): New.
	* elf-bfd.h (struct elf_backend_data): Add
	obj_attrs_handle_unknown.
	(_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_low,
	_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_list): Declare.
	* elf32-arm.c (elf32_arm_obj_attrs_handle_unknown): New.  Split
	out from elf32_arm_merge_eabi_attributes.
	(elf32_arm_merge_eabi_attributes): Use
	_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_low and
	_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_list.
	(elf_backend_obj_attrs_handle_unknown): Define.
	* elfxx-target.h (elf_backend_obj_attrs_handle_unknown): Define.
	(elfNN_bed): Update initializer.

/* Merge an unknown processor-specific attribute TAG, within the range
of known attributes, from IBFD into OBFD; return TRUE if the link
is OK, FALSE if it must fail. */
bfd_boolean
_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_low (bfd *ibfd, bfd *obfd, int tag)
{
obj_attribute *in_attr;
obj_attribute *out_attr;
bfd *err_bfd = NULL;
bfd_boolean result = TRUE;
in_attr = elf_known_obj_attributes_proc (ibfd);
out_attr = elf_known_obj_attributes_proc (obfd);
if (out_attr[tag].i != 0 || out_attr[tag].s != NULL)
err_bfd = obfd;
else if (in_attr[tag].i != 0 || in_attr[tag].s != NULL)
err_bfd = ibfd;
if (err_bfd != NULL)
result
= get_elf_backend_data (err_bfd)->obj_attrs_handle_unknown (err_bfd, tag);
/* Only pass on attributes that match in both inputs. */
if (in_attr[tag].i != out_attr[tag].i
|| in_attr[tag].s != out_attr[tag].s
|| (in_attr[tag].s != NULL && out_attr[tag].s != NULL
&& strcmp (in_attr[tag].s, out_attr[tag].s) != 0))
{
out_attr[tag].i = 0;
out_attr[tag].s = NULL;
}
return result;
}
/* Merge the lists of unknown processor-specific attributes, outside
the known range, from IBFD into OBFD; return TRUE if the link is
OK, FALSE if it must fail. */
bfd_boolean
_bfd_elf_merge_unknown_attribute_list (bfd *ibfd, bfd *obfd)
{
obj_attribute_list *in_list;
obj_attribute_list *out_list;
obj_attribute_list **out_listp;
bfd_boolean result = TRUE;
in_list = elf_other_obj_attributes_proc (ibfd);
out_listp = &elf_other_obj_attributes_proc (obfd);
out_list = *out_listp;
for (; in_list || out_list; )
{
bfd *err_bfd = NULL;
int err_tag = 0;
/* The tags for each list are in numerical order. */
/* If the tags are equal, then merge. */
if (out_list && (!in_list || in_list->tag > out_list->tag))
{
/* This attribute only exists in obfd. We can't merge, and we don't
know what the tag means, so delete it. */
err_bfd = obfd;
err_tag = out_list->tag;
*out_listp = out_list->next;
out_list = *out_listp;
}
else if (in_list && (!out_list || in_list->tag < out_list->tag))
{
/* This attribute only exists in ibfd. We can't merge, and we don't
know what the tag means, so ignore it. */
err_bfd = ibfd;
err_tag = in_list->tag;
in_list = in_list->next;
}
else /* The tags are equal. */
{
/* As present, all attributes in the list are unknown, and
therefore can't be merged meaningfully. */
err_bfd = obfd;
err_tag = out_list->tag;
/* Only pass on attributes that match in both inputs. */
if (in_list->attr.i != out_list->attr.i
|| in_list->attr.s != out_list->attr.s
|| (in_list->attr.s && out_list->attr.s
&& strcmp (in_list->attr.s, out_list->attr.s) != 0))
{
/* No match. Delete the attribute. */
*out_listp = out_list->next;
out_list = *out_listp;
}
else
{
/* Matched. Keep the attribute and move to the next. */
out_list = out_list->next;
in_list = in_list->next;
}
}
if (err_bfd)
result = result
&& get_elf_backend_data (err_bfd)->obj_attrs_handle_unknown (err_bfd,
err_tag);
}
return result;
}
